Mars 1 (2MV-4 No.2)

Mars 1, also known as 1962 Beta Nu 1, Mars 2MV-4 and Sputnik 23, was an automatic interplanetary station launched in the direction of Mars on November 1, 1962,[1][2] the first of the Soviet Mars probe program, with the intent of flying by the planet at a distance of about 11,000 km (6,800 mi). It was designed to image the surface and send back data on cosmic radiation, micrometeoroid impacts and Mars’ magnetic field, radiation environment, atmospheric structure, and possible organic compounds.[1][2] read more

Mars 2MV-3 No.1

Mars 2MV-3 No.1[1][2] also known as Sputnik 24 in the West, was a Soviet spacecraft, which was launched in 1962 as part of the Mars program, and was intended to land on the surface of Mars.[3][4] Due to a problem with the rocket which launched it, it did not depart low Earth orbit,[5] and it decayed several days later. It was the only Mars 2MV-3 spacecraft to be launched.[2]

Mariner 4

Mariner 4 (together with Mariner 3 known as Mariner–Mars 1964) was the fourth in a series of spacecraft intended for planetary exploration in a flyby mode. It was designed to conduct closeup scientific observations of Mars and to transmit these observations to Earth. Launched on November 28, 1964,[2] Mariner 4 performed the first successful flyby of the planet Mars, returning the first close-up pictures of the Martian surface. It captured the first images of another planet ever returned from deep space; their depiction of a cratered, seemingly dead world largely changed the scientific community’s view of life on Mars.[3][4] Other mission objectives were to perform field and particle measurements in interplanetary space in the vicinity of Mars and to provide experience in and knowledge of the engineering capabilities for interplanetary flights of long duration. On December 21, 1967, communications with Mariner 4 were terminated. read more

Zond 2 (3MV-4A No.2)

Zond 2 was a Soviet space probe, a member of the Zond program, and was the sixth Soviet spacecraft to attempt a flyby of Mars.[1][dead link] [2][dead link] (See Exploration of Mars)[3] It was launched on 30th November 1964 at 13:12 UTC onboard Molniya 8K78 launch vehicle from Baikonur Cosmodrome, Kazakhstan, Russia. The spacecraft was intended to survey Mars but lost communication before arrival.

Mariner 6 and 7

Mariner 6 and Mariner 7 (Mariner Mars 69A and Mariner Mars 69B) were two unmanned NASA space probes that completed the first dual mission to Mars in 1969 as part of NASA’s wider Mariner program. Mariner 6 was launched from Launch Complex 36B at Cape Canaveral Air Force Station[3] and Mariner 7 from Launch Complex 36A at Cape Kennedy.[2] The craft[clarification needed] flew over the equator and south polar regions, analyzing the atmosphere and the surface with remote sensors, and recording and relaying hundreds of pictures. The mission’s goals were to study the surface and atmosphere of Mars during close flybys, in order to establish the basis for future investigations, particularly those relevant to the search for extraterrestrial life, and to demonstrate and develop technologies required for future Mars missions. Mariner 6 also had the objective of providing experience and data which would be useful in programming the Mariner 7 encounter five days later. read more

2M No.522 (1969B)[4]

Mars 2M No.522,[1] also known as Mars M-69 No.522 and sometimes identified by NASA as Mars 1969B, was a Soviet spacecraft which was lost in a launch failure in 1969.[2] It consisted of an orbiter. The spacecraft was intended to image the surface of Mars using three cameras, with images being encoded for transmission back to Earth as television signals. It also carried a radiometer, a series of spectrometers, and an instrument to detect water vapour in the atmosphere of Mars. It was one of two Mars 2M spacecraft, along with Mars 2M No.521, which was launched in 1969 as part of the Mars program. Neither launch was successful.[3] read more

Mariner 8

Mariner-H (Mariner Mars ’71), also commonly known as Mariner 8, was (along with Mariner 9) part of the Mariner Mars ’71 project. It was intended to go into Mars orbit and return images and data, but a launch vehicle failure prevented Mariner 8 from achieving Earth orbit and the spacecraft reentered into the Atlantic Ocean shortly after launch.[1]

Kosmos 419

Kosmos 419 (Russian: Космос 419 meaning Cosmos 419), also known as 3MS No.170 was a failed Soviet spacecraft intended to visit Mars. The spacecraft was launched on May 10, 1971, however due to an upper stage malfunction it failed to depart low Earth orbit.

Mars 2 (4M No.171)

The Mars 2 was an uncrewed space probe of the Mars program, a series of uncrewed Mars landers and orbiters launched by the Soviet Union May 19, 1971. The Mars 2 and Mars 3 missions consisted of identical spacecraft, each with an orbiter and an attached lander. The orbiter is identical to the Venera 9 bus or orbiter. The type of bus/orbiter is the 4MV. They were launched by a Proton-K heavy launch vehicle with a Blok D upper stage. The lander of Mars 2 became the first human-made object to reach the surface of Mars, although the landing system failed and the lander was lost. read more
